Epic claims interoperability feature averted over 5.8M duplicative imaging exams in 1 year

This would amount to between 400,000 and 500,000 unnecessary scans each month, the Verona, Wisconsin-based vendor said in recently published research.

CDC considers letting nurse practitioners, physician assistants read X-rays under federal program

The agency's “B Reader Program” trains and certifies physicians to classify chest radiographs of workers participating in federal health surveillance programs.

Hologic finalizes $350M acquisition of ultrasound imaging device developer

Gynesonics developed and sells the Sonata System, the first FDA-cleared product for diagnosis and treatment of certain symptomatic fibroids.

14-hospital Allegheny Health Network selects radiologist as next chief medical officer

Bethany Casagranda, DO, MBA, has served as chair of AHN’s Imaging Institute since 2017, growing the network’s radiologist roster from 28 to 124.
